afternoons, evenings, and weekends. Responsibilities and Duties
Conduct functional behavior assessments (FBA), VB MAPP, AFLS and
ABLLS-R assessments. Develop treatment plan based on the findings
of the FBA using evidence-based practices. Provide clinical
supervision of BHT or RBT workers Direct 1:1 ABA therapy in the
home, school and community environments. Implementation of
individualized treatment plans and programs as written by the
supervising BCBA. Collect data during each session with the client.
reduction of challenging behaviorsaggression, property destruction,
tantrums, etc. Analyze data to adapt and adjust programming.
Provide support to parents, teachers, or community officials.
Provide clinical support to direct care staff. Implement
consequences relating to appropriate and inappropriate behavior.
Establish coordination of communication with other supporting
agencies. Exchange information clearly and concisely with the
appropriate parties and concerns. Complete and submit all paperwork
including documentation of session notes, encounter logs, treatment
plans and assessments in a timely manner. Qualifications and Skills
